Travel Vaccinations
Travel health is a very complex area of nursing and we will never offer travel advice over the telephone.
The practice holds a travel clinic once per month, usually on the last Tuesday or Friday of the month. We encourage patients to contact us well in advance regarding their travel health needs, and no later than 8 weeks prior to travel. Each patient must complete a travel health assessment form. This must be returned to the practice no later than 1 week before your travel health appointment. Please collect a travel health assessment form from the surgery (or click on the link to print this off at home).
We will then be able to advise you with regards to vaccinations that are recommended or required for your trip. Please be aware that the practice does not provide non-NHS vaccines or non-NHS anti-malarial prescriptions and that you may be advised to source these at a private clinic, external to the practice.
We recommend that patients access the following website for advice with regards to bite avoidance, drinking water etc - fitfortravel.nhs.uk
